The Scarcity of Comprehensive Sex Education

Lea’s personal experience highlights the global issue of inadequate sex education. Growing up in Bulgaria, she received no formal sex education. Biology classes briefly touched upon the human body but offered no insight into sexuality, relationships, or pleasure. This absence of information isn’t unique; many individuals worldwide lack access to comprehensive sex education. The consequences are far-reaching, leading to misinformation, unhealthy relationships, and a lack of understanding of one’s own body. This is not simply about the mechanics of reproduction; it’s about understanding pleasure, consent, boundaries, and healthy communication.

The limited sex education that some do receive often focuses solely on reproduction, omitting crucial aspects of pleasure and healthy sexual development. This leaves individuals ill-equipped to navigate their sexuality and form healthy relationships. The result is a population grappling with misinformation and shame, hindering their ability to experience healthy and fulfilling sexual lives. This inadequate education perpetuates harmful myths and misconceptions, impacting physical and emotional health.

Lea contrasts this with her own upbringing, where a sex-positive approach allowed open communication and age-appropriate answers to her questions. This model, where children’s questions are answered honestly and without shame, fosters a healthy relationship with their bodies and sexuality. It contrasts starkly with the fear and discomfort many adults associate with sex, a fear often stemming from inadequate or shame-filled sex education.

The Impact of Censorship on Sexual Health and Relationships

Censorship doesn’t merely create a knowledge gap; it actively harms individuals’ sexual health and relationships. This lack of accurate information leads to misunderstandings about sexual health, creating an environment where individuals suffer silently, believing pain or discomfort is normal. This is particularly true for women who may endure painful periods, intercourse, or other issues without seeking help, believing it is normal.

The consequences of this silence are profound. Relationships falter as partners struggle with sexual incompatibility or pain. Women may experience discomfort and pain for extended periods without understanding the underlying cause or seeking medical assistance. The lack of readily available, accurate information leaves individuals feeling isolated and helpless, resulting in decreased sexual activity and overall dissatisfaction.

This contributes to a growing crisis of decreased sexual activity and relationship difficulties. The internet, while a potential source of information, often falls short due to censorship, algorithms, and the silencing of content creators. This leaves individuals to navigate their sexual health and relationships with limited resources and often harmful misinformation. The ability to access trusted information is essential for fostering healthy sexuality and relationships.

The Role of Misogyny and Sexism in Sex Education Censorship

The issue of censorship is intrinsically linked to misogyny and sexism. While products like Viagra are widely advertised, discussions of female sexual health, breastfeeding, or other aspects of women’s bodies often face censorship. This disparity highlights a double standard, where men’s sexuality is openly discussed and promoted, while women’s sexuality is often shamed, silenced, or ignored.

Lea’s observation that men also suffer from this censorship is crucial. The control over women’s bodies and reproductive rights indirectly impacts men. Restricting access to abortion or contraception affects men as much as it does women. The resulting financial burdens of unplanned pregnancies, legal complexities, and strained relationships impact both partners. It’s a misconception that these issues only affect women; the consequences are shared.

The control of information about women’s bodies is about power, not morality. Those who benefit from this power structure perpetuate censorship. This power dynamic manifests in various ways, from the pervasive slut-shaming culture to restrictive laws regarding women’s reproductive rights. It is a system designed to maintain control and silence.

The Hidden World of Sex Tech and Femme Tech: Innovation Silenced

The world of sex tech and femme tech is booming with innovative products and services aimed at improving sexual health and well-being. Yet, these advancements often remain hidden from the public due to censorship. Companies struggle to advertise their products, leading to limited reach and a missed opportunity to improve the lives of countless individuals.

These innovations cover a vast spectrum of needs and concerns. For women, advancements in managing menopause symptoms and overall female health are remarkable. Yet, censorship prevents many from accessing this crucial information, limiting their ability to improve their quality of life. For men, innovative products address concerns about erectile dysfunction or premature ejaculation, yet these advancements also face censorship, keeping potentially beneficial solutions out of reach. The silencing of this innovation perpetuates the struggle for healthier sexual lives and relationships.

The lack of visibility for these products illustrates a wider issue of control and power. Companies face immense challenges advertising and promoting sexual wellness products, even facing penalties for attempting to provide this crucial information to their target audience. The inability to reach potential customers limits their growth and potential impact.
